DHAKA, Sept 16, 2025 (BSS) - Chinese Ambassador to Bangladesh Yao Wen paid a courtesy call on Inspector General of Police (IGP) Baharul Alam at the Police Headquarters in Dhaka today.

During the meeting, the Ambassador handed over 49 computers and 49 printers to support the technical capacity of Bangladesh Police.

The IGP thanked the Chinese envoy for the generous support and described China as an important development partner of Bangladesh. 

He expressed hope that cooperation between Bangladesh Police and China would continue to strengthen in the future.

Ambassador Yao Wen also requested the IGP's assistance in ensuring the security of Chinese nationals working on various projects across the country. 

The IGP assured full cooperation in this regard.

Officials from both the Chinese Embassy and Bangladesh Police were present at the meeting.
